Splet27. sep. 2024 · The department also waived penalties for businesses with cumulative liability exceeding $150,000 (for sales and use tax, room occupancy excise tax, or meals tax), so long as they file returns and pay the taxes due by November 1, 2024. However, these businesses are still accruing interest on taxes not paid by their original due date.
